- Description
- Covers Margaret Harris Amsler, Barbara Nachtrieb Armstrong, Harriet Spiller Daggett, Joan Miday Krauskopf, Maria Minnette Massey, Marygold Shire Melli, Soia Mentschikoff, Dorothy Wright Nelson, Ellen Ash Peters, Janet Mary Riley, Miriam Theresa Rooney, Clemence Myers Smith, Jeanette Ozanne Smith, and Helen Elsie Steinbinder plus some professors who taught during the 1960s, 1970s, and 1980s including Ruth Bader Ginsburg.
